导航:首页 > 研究方法 > 平台项目规模分析方法

平台项目规模分析方法

发布时间:2025-01-28 13:52:35

‘壹’ 软件系统规模估算方法论介绍——功能点分析法

众所周知,软件系统复杂性极高,评估其规模对项目成本、资源需求、工期及报价至关重要。当前主要评估方法分为技术视角与业务视角两大类。技术视角方法侧重开发者角度,如源代码行数、数据库表及函数数量;业务视角方法则从用户角度出发,与技术无关,如功能点、故事点、用例点及对象点等。专家估算法基于技术视角,适用于内部团队,但标准难以量化,差异性大,难以达成一致。在与外部组织商讨关键项目目标时,业务视角更为必要。功能点分析法,一种基于业务视角的国际标准方法论,能客观度量用户需求及功能,提供不依赖特定技术的规模评估手段,适合不同项目与组织间的度量一致性。此方法简便、相对客观,使用行业标准数据,易于被接受。

功能点分析法的核心在于度量用户需求及功能,采用五个基本要素进行量化:内部逻辑文件(ILF)、外部接口文件(EIF)、外部输入(EI)、外部输出(EO)及外部查询(EQ)。简而言之,业务实体为ILF,外部系统接口为EIF,新增、删除、修改操作为EI,查询操作为EQ,接口或报表为EO。ILF与EIF为静态数据,而EI、EO及EQ为动态数据。

快速功能点法(2点法)以需求分析及可研报告为基础,评估项目中涉及的ILF与EIF数量,通过公式FP = ∑(35 * ILF + 15 * EIF)进行计算。初步功能点法(5点法)在设计阶段引入更细的评估粒度,使用公式FP = ∑(15 * ILF + 10 * EIF + 4 * EI + 5 * EO + 4 * EQ),纳入更多要素,提供更准确的评估。标准功能点法则引入功能复杂度、DET(字段数量)与RET(表数量)等控制因子,进行更精细的衡量,以求更准确的评估结果。

计算方法的延伸是将功能点数量转换为实际工作量、成本及工期。通过功能点法得到功能点数量后,结合每个功能点所需工时进行计算,通常软件公司会有自己的经验数据。若无积累,则可参考权威数据报告,如《中国软件行业基准数据报告》,该报告提供了生产率、维护生产率、缺陷密度、工作量分布及人员费率等基础数据,用于进一步的计算与分析。

功能点分析法的优点包括基于良好计算标准,易于理解和接受,适用于新项目、升级项目及维护项目,与技术无关,计算简便且一致性高,利于不同组织间比较。然而,其缺点在于仅考虑可见部分的复杂度,忽视了系统内部复杂性,功能复杂度划分相对粗略,对复杂功能的统计误差较大。

综上所述,功能点分析法作为评估软件规模的优秀方法论,特别适用于业务视角,有助于优化成本、增强竞争力。对于采用成熟开发平台或二次开发的产品,能显着降低成本,提升市场竞争力。

‘贰’ 项目工程分析的方法

项目工程分析的方法包括多种系统化和结构化的技术手段,旨在深入探究项目的各个方面,以确保项目的顺利进行并实现预期目标。以下是一些常用的项目工程分析方法

首先,逻辑框架法是一种通过明确项目的目标、假设、活动和所需资源来帮助项目经理进行项目规划和管理的方法。它建立了一个清晰的逻辑框架,使得项目团队能够更好地理解项目需求和实施步骤。

其次,系统分析法在项目工程分析中占有重要地位。这种方法将项目视为一个整体,并分析各部分之间的相互关系和影响。通过系统分析,项目团队能够识别出项目中的关键要素和潜在问题,从而制定出更为有效的解决方案。

另外,成本效益分析法是评估项目投资价值的一种常用方法。它通过比较项目带来的收益与所需成本,帮助项目决策者做出更合理的经济决策。这种方法不仅考虑直接的财务成本和收益,还综合考虑时间、资源等其他因素的价值。

此外,模拟法在项目工程分析中也发挥着重要作用。通过构建模型来模拟实际工程,项目团队可以预测工程的结果和可能出现的问题。这种方法使得项目团队能够在项目实施前对潜在风险进行评估,并提前制定相应的应对措施。

除了上述方法外,还有故障树分析法、质量管理方法、项目管理方法以及强度分析、多标准决策分析等。这些方法在项目工程分析的各个阶段都具有重要的应用价值。

总的来说,项目工程分析的方法多种多样,每种方法都有其独特的适用范围和实施步骤。在实际应用中,项目团队应根据项目的具体需求和特点选择合适的方法进行分析。同时,随着科技的不断进步和创新,项目工程分析的方法也在不断发展和完善,为项目的成功实施提供了更为强大的支持。

举例来说,在一个大型购物中心建设项目的工程分析中,项目团队可能会综合运用多种分析方法。在项目规划阶段,团队可能会使用逻辑框架法和系统分析法来明确项目目标和资源需求,并识别出潜在的风险和挑战。在项目实施阶段,团队可能会利用成本效益分析法来评估不同施工方案的经济性,并使用模拟法来预测施工过程中的可能问题。同时,团队还可能会采用故障树分析法来识别可能导致施工事故的根本原因,并采取相应的预防措施。通过这些方法的综合运用,项目团队能够更全面地了解项目的各个方面,确保项目的顺利进行并实现预期效益。

阅读全文

与平台项目规模分析方法相关的资料

热点内容
毒品检测抽样方法 浏览:296
手机面图标怎么设置方法 浏览:898
天猫入驻最简单的方法 浏览:144
机械装配常用的装配方法 浏览:686
米兰花浇水的方法和技巧 浏览:988
手机倒车镜使用方法 浏览:255
风疹最快治疗方法 浏览:407
苯的化学方法有哪些 浏览:1
班主任提高学生积极性有什么方法 浏览:641
无机及分析化学的科学方法 浏览:755
眼睛散光有什么好的恢复方法 浏览:835
肩周炎颈椎病的治疗方法有哪些 浏览:401
室内机的安装方法视频 浏览:221
收款怎么说比较好求方法 浏览:94
内地鉴别农耕时间的方法 浏览:510
75除以99简便方法 浏览:838
各种辨证方法如何运用中医 浏览:580
玻璃餐桌安装方法 浏览:444
有虫子咬床怎么解决方法 浏览:938
绿宝花的种植方法和图片 浏览:650